About Spice Carriage

Tucked away at the end of Barnet High Street, the Spice Carriage has been a favourite with local curry connoisseurs for many years. The narrow but cosy restaurant has been designed to look like a railway carriage, complete with traditional décor and comfortable booths that are perfect for long lunches or full-on feasts with family and friends. The menu includes familiar favourites like chicken tikka masala and lamb jalfrezi, all cooked using traditional recipes and fresh herbs and spices. If you’re looking for something a little different, try a Spice Carriage specialty like sizzling tandoori chicken with garlic and coriander, or the chilli fish tikka – a Bangladeshi dish with a delicious fiery sauce. For first class Indian food in Barnet, you can’t go wrong here.
